Great small city - 4/10/2011
School system rated within top 6% of ALL U.S. high schools. Low crime rate, friendly people, and good sense of community. Limited restaurants and entertainment, but nearby Evansville has everything! 10 min. from a public university, USI. Some decent jobs, but again, short commute to Evansville. Predominantly white area. A good place to live. Read More
